Title: Enforcement or Negotiation: Constructing a Regulatory Bureaucracy
Description: Albany, State University of New York, (1986). orig.boards. 23x15cm, xi, 193 pp. Binding corner bumps, minor rubbing, VG. ¶ Contents: Regulation & the State: The Rise of Regulation; Regulation & Theories of the State: Neo-Marxist Theories; The Regulatory Process: Choices & Constraints; Styles of Regulation: A Typological Analysis of the Regulatory Process; Stages of the Regulatory Process...Surface Mining & the Environment: Trends in American Coal Production; The Surface Coal Mining Process; The Destructive Effects of Early Surface Coal Mining; The Anti-Strip Mining Movement; The Battle to Enact Legislation: 90th Congress (1968): Hearings; Interim Events; 92nd & 93rd Congresses: Hearings & Legislation; 93rd & 94th Congresses: Legislation & Vetoes: 95th Congress: The Surface Mining Control & Reclamation Act of 1977; The Social Construction of the Agency: Constructing Legislative History; Constructing the Organization; Constraining Factors...;The Social Construction of Regulations...The OSM's Rule-Making Process; Federal Surface Mining Regulations...The Inspection & Enforcement Program: The Guiding Ideology; Creating an Enforcement Process; Industry & State Opposition; Evaluation of Enforcement; Sanctioning Corporate Offenders...; Regional Variation in Inspection & Enforcement: Regulatory Enforcement Styles; Contrasts in Regional Enforcement Activity; The Agency under Siege: The Revolt of the States; The Coal Industry's Counterattack; The States-Industry Coalition; "Friendly" Sniping by Environmentalists... A Theoretical Reprise...The Office of Surface Mining Since 1980...Appendix: Methodology.
